I believe children deserve the same materials, the same tools, and the same respect as an adult working in design. Every workshop starts with a question, a constraint, a challenge—and ends with an object a child can hold, explain, and keep.

The best designers don't just build; they teach us to look at space, materials, and possibilities through a completely different lens. What I develop here is not just manual skill—it is creative confidence, spatial reasoning, and the quiet art of thinking with your hands.

Here, the process matters as much as the result. I teach children to see mistakes not as failures, but as valuable information to iterate, modify, and perfect their ideas. This is a mental restructuring that turns frustration into curiosity and builds real resilience in the face of complex problems.

There are no screens, no grades, and no performance pressure. Just attentive, expert-led creative time in a calm studio environment where kids truly thrive—and parents tell me their children continue building, sketching, and talking about their projects at home for days afterward.

By learning how to translate abstract concepts into real, three-dimensional structures, children gain a crucial head start in geometry, logical reasoning, and critical thinking that will serve them far beyond the design table.

When a child realizes they can shape the world around them—and that they have a steady hand to guide them—they stop being passive observers. They become makers. This is the foundation of Atelier Begüm: providing the room, the tools, and the belief that every child is capable of designing something beautiful, structured, and entirely their own.

Six themes built around story and making.

90 MINUTES · $40 single · $200 program (6 weeks)

Week 1

Secret Room

A room full of mysteries — hidden panels, moving doors, and structural surprises. Children explore the thrill of structural secrets.

Week 2

Mr Owl's Treehouse

A giant treehouse with secret rooms, rope bridges, an observation deck, and hidden entrances.

Week 3

Candy Shop

A delicious design challenge where everything is inspired by sweets — cookie display cases, candy windows, and colorful counters.

Week 4

Animal Hotel

Pick a guest — panda, tiger, penguin, etc. — and design the hotel layout that guest would actually like.

Week 5

Underwater Adventure

Coral homes, sea-creature playgrounds, submarine stations, bubble towers. Designing for water instead of land.

Week 6 · Finale

Dream City

The grand finale! Children bring their previous 5 completed projects and arrange them onto a solid wood base sheet. They will focus on decorating, coloring, designing roads, and adding trees or other custom scenery using the provided studio materials.
